Overview

NHS Greater Glasgow and Clyde is one of the largest healthcare systems in the UK employing around 40,000 staff in a wide range of clinical and non‑clinical professions and job roles. We deliver acute hospital, primary, community and mental health care services to a population of over 1.15 million and a wider population of 2.2 million when our regional and national services are included.

Shift Pattern

The shift pattern of this post consists of 22.2 hours per week.

Responsibilities

The post holder will ensure that an effective and efficient secretarial and administrative service is delivered to the multi‑disciplinary team which comprises Managerial, Psychology, Nursing and Occupational Therapy staff within adult community mental health services across Glasgow City CHP.

This will include reception duties, data input, record management and general typing.

The post holder works independently most of the time managing calls, emails and team workload. The post holder will be required to deal with referrals and enquiries through a single point of access and also support the generic functions and duties of the wider administrative team across the sector and beyond as required.
